L&G posted a rare update of its main figures in Q1 20, as it usually only releases half-year results. The company said it is in a good shape, with a developing Pension Risk Transfer business (transactions of £1.2bn with a business pipeline of £26bn). Annuity sales are growing and the asset management business recorded net inflows of £10.6bn. The insurer will issue Tier 2 subordianted debt and said its capital position remains solid.
